# 93476b1e 17-Dec-2012 Gabor Juhos <juhosg@openwrt.org>

ath9k: fix column header comments for some initval arrays

Some 3-column initval arrays have wrong comments. The
column of these arrays is indexed by the 'freqIndex'
variable in 'ar5008_hw_process_ini' which only depends
on the actual band.

The 'initvals' tool from 'qca-swiss-army-knife' prints
the correct comment lines for these arrays, since commit
'atheros-initvals: fix comments for non-fastclock 3-column tables'
however the comments were not refreshed in ath9k.

The patch contains no functional changes.

# 14fec8d9 15-Feb-2012 Felix Fietkau <nbd@openwrt.org>

ath9k_hw: remove duplicate initvals

Comparing SHA1 checksums of the initval tables has shown that there are many
tables that are 100% identical.

iniBank{0,1,2,3,7} and iniBB_RfGain are shared by AR5416, AR913x, AR9160
iniBank6 is shared between AR5416 and AR9160
iniBank6TPC is shared between AR913x and AR9160

iniPcieSerdes is the same for all AR9002 based devices

The CCK FIR coefficients are shared between AR9271 and AR9287

Getting rid of those duplicates saves about 7.5k uncompressed (on MIPS).

For AR9003 and later there are some duplicates as well, but I've decided to
leave them in for now, as the initvals for those chips are still actively
maintained by QCA.

# b8b0b974 29-Aug-2011 Felix Fietkau <nbd@openwrt.org>

ath9k_hw: drop an unused column in AR5008-AR9002 initvals

It was used for the defunct 'turbo' mode which was never implemented in the
driver. Saves ~7.5k uncompressed
